Spin-parity analysis of p¯p→E(1420)X

Abstract
A Dalitz-plot analysis of 620 E(1420) events was performed on the reaction p¯p→(KS0 K+ π)X at 6.6 GeV/c, obtained at the Brookhaven National Laboratory Multiparticle Spectrometer facility. The mass and width of the E(1420) peak are 1424±3 and 60±10 MeV, respectively. The best fit to the E(1420) is a JPG =0+ state with a substantial δπ decay mode, produced over a large nonresonant background of 1++ K*K and phase space. This fit shows the same characteristics as the E(1420) observed in our companion πp experiment.
